- GENERAL INFORMATION: Naval Facilities Engineering Command (NAVFAC) Far East, Contract Execution Team, is seeking information on establishing an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ity, Custodial, Integrated Solid Waste Management and Medical Waste Disposal Services at Fleet Activities Chinhae, Korea for a period of three (3) months. This notice does not constitute a Request for Proposal (RFP). The intent of this notice is to identify potential offerors for market research purposes. The information received will be utilized within the Navy to facilitate the decision making processes and will not be disclosed outside of the Government. This notice is not to be construed as a commitment by the Government for any purpose other than market research. In accordance with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) 15.201(e), responses to this notice are not offers and cannot be accepted by the Government to form a binding contract. The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) Code for this procurement is 561720 “ Janitorial Services. CONTRACTOR LICENSING REQUIREMENTS: Any contract resulting from this solicitation will be awarded and performed in its entirety in the country of Korea. Contractors must be duly authorized to operate and conduct business in Korea and must fully comply with all laws, decrees, labor standards, and regulations of Korea during the performance of the contract. Contractors must be registered to do business and possess an appropriate license to perform work under this contract. Offerors will be required to provide verification on such license prior to award of any task order to the Contracting Officer if such information is not already on file with or available to the Contracting Officer.
